To sell a house in Pennsylvania, does everybody on the title have to agree? jQuery removeAttr() Method - GeeksforGeeks javascript remove "disabled" attribute from html input if true, the toggleAttribute method adds an attribute named name. The value of the DOM property may be different, for instance the, If you have suggestions what to improve - please. Why does a flat plate create less lift than an airfoil at the same AoA? When you remove the attribute you just specify the name of the attribute Why is the town of Olivenza not as heavily politicized as other territorial disputes? Element: toggleAttribute() method - Web APIs | MDN 4 Answers Sorted by: 3 HTML5 defines a method, getElementsByClassName (), that allows us to select sets of document elements based on the identifiers in their class attribute. Add or delete a property of an object in JavaScript The ES6/ES7 way is the most common one these days because of purity. If you need to remove the disabled attribute, use the removeAttribute () method. consider buying me a coffee ($5) or two ($10). What can I do about a fellow player who forgets his class features and metagames? Let us say that you have got the following anchor link: Now you want to remove the title attribute from the above tag. The removeAttributeNode () method removes an Attr object, and returns the removed object. HTML DOM Element setAttribute() Method - W3Schools Considering your solution this is more better and efficient. How to prevent an input from being disabled? How is XP still vulnerable behind a NAT + firewall. Web hosting by Digital Ocean | CDN by StackPath. Was Hunter Biden's legal team legally required to publicly disclose his proposed plea agreement? By using JQuery you could use class selectors and then remove associated attributes by using the removeattr function: I'm sorry, i saw your code incorrectly. But what about non-standard, custom ones? JavaScript hasAttribute(): Check If an Element Has a Specified Attribute Updated on July 5, 2022 JavaScript Development By Tania Rascia English Introduction In the previous tutorial in this series, " How To Make Changes to the DOM ," we covered how to create, insert, replace, and remove elements from the Document Object Model (DOM) with built-in methods. To fix this you can use closest() to get the nearest common ancestor, then find() the .btn elements, excluding the one which was clicked. </div> Step 2) Add CSS: Style the specified class name: Example .mystyle { width: 100%; padding: 25px; The removeAttribute () also works for HTML5 data-* attributes. Is it rude to tell an editor that a paper I received to review is out of scope of their journal? For instance, if an elem has an attribute named "data-about", its available as elem.dataset.about. What would happen if lightning couldn't strike the ground due to a layer of unconductive gas? If The disabled attribute can be set to keep a user from using the element until some other condition has been met (like selecting a checkbox, etc.). Asking for help, clarification, or responding to other answers. When writing HTML, we use a lot of standard attributes. This is what I tried so far. This method removes the specified attribute from the element. Trouble selecting q-q plot settings with statsmodels. All attributes are accessible by using the following methods: These methods operate exactly with whats written in HTML. The newsletter is sent every week and includes early access to clear, concise, and An attribute to remove; as of version 1.7, it can be a space-separated list of attributes. "To fill the pot to its top", would be properly describe what I mean to say? value to the string "null". $ (document).ready (function () { $ ('input.article-vote').removeAttr ('checked'); $ ('input#rating' + id).attr ('checked', 'checked'); }); As can be seen I am remove the attribute by class and selecting the target by id. Why do the more recent landers across Mars and Moon not use the cushion approach? Making statements based on opinion; back them up with references or personal experience. How to Add and Remove Readonly Attribute in Javascript There are multiple ways to create an option dynamically and add it to a <select> in JavaScript. Not the answer you're looking for? What does soaking-out run capacitor mean? Description: Remove an attribute from each element in the set of matched elements. Securing Cabinet to wall: better to use two anchors to drywall or one screw into stud? HTML5 defines a method, getElementsByClassName(), that allows us to select sets of document elements based on the identifiers in their class attribute. An attribute to remove; as of version 1.7, it can be a space-separated list of attributes. Visit Mozilla Corporations not-for-profit parent, the Mozilla Foundation.Portions of this content are 19982023 by individual mozilla.org contributors. For example, to remove the data-role attribute from the anchor link, you can use the following code: The removeAttribute() method works in all modern browsers, and IE8 and above. I need to learn how to add the hidden attribute back to the button element to hide it again. Second, add the option to the select element. 600), Medical research made understandable with AI (ep. Asking for help, clarification, or responding to other answers. For a list of trademarks of the OpenJS Foundation, please see our Trademark Policy and Trademark List.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ide, The future of collective knowledge sharing. 1 const baseObject = { 2 firstName: "Joe", 3 lastName: "Doe", 4 age: 23, 5 }; 6 7 // Adding a property called company to an object 8 const addedPropertyObject = { 9 .baseObject, 10 How do you add/remove hidden in <p hidden> with JavaScript This is quite different from using the CSS property display to control the visibility of an element. How is XP still vulnerable behind a NAT + firewall. vanilla js, removeAttribute isn't supported in IE. Did you try my snippet? But technically no one limits us, and if there arent enough, we can add our own. Like this article? Connect and share knowledge within a single location that is structured and easy to search. setAttribute () Method: This method adds the defined attribute to an element, and gives it the defined value. Why do "'inclusive' access" textbooks normally self-destruct after a year or so? time. You can also subscribe to Attributes and properties - The Modern JavaScript Tutorial Jquery: Setting/removing two attributes at once, I need to remove an attribute from an element after it is clicked with JavaScript, Using jQuery to add/remove attributes if another attribute is added/removed, Remove data attribute on click function using jQuery, How to add and remove an input element with attributes using jquery. What does "grinning" mean in Hans Christian Andersen's "The Snow Queen"? I tried removing the attribute and setting it to false but neither of them worked. Can fictitious forces always be described by gravity fields in General Relativity? Why do the more recent landers across Mars and Moon not use the cushion approach? What for? If the specified attribute does not exist, removeAttribute () returns without generating an error. easy-to-follow tutorials, and other stuff I think you'd enjoy! write about modern JavaScript, Node.js, Spring Boot, core Java, RESTful APIs, and all things Element: removeAttribute() method - Web APIs | MDN "https://code.jquery.com/jquery-3.7.0.js". We can alter them. Not able to Save data in physical file while using docker through Sitecore Powershell. For instance, "type" is standard for (HTMLInputElement), but not for (HTMLBodyElement). How to add, remove, and toggle CSS classes in JavaScript Find centralized, trusted content and collaborate around the technologies you use most. If you wish to remove an attribute, call el.removeAttribute("data-color"); Insert a Node before the first Child of an Element, Insert a Node after the last Child of an Element, insertBefore Insert a Node Before Another, insertAfter Insert a Node After Another, Remove Items from Select Element Conditionally, Removing Items from a Select Element Conditionally, Setting the value of a Boolean attribute to. the attribute already exists, the value is updated; otherwise a new attribute is added Follow me on otherwise. In the following example, setAttribute() is used to set attributes on a Should I use 'denote' or 'be'? @Alnitak you're correct - I changed my mind on my approach while writing the example and forgot to update the description :) I've put it back to how it originally was. Is there an accessibility standard for using icons vs text in menus? $ ('.btn').click (function () { $ (this).attr ("title", "selected").siblings ().removeAttr ("title", "selected"); }); Could you set an ID on the

tag and interact with it that way? You can use the hidden attribute for that. <button type="button btn-primary" id="peekaboo-button" hidden>Peekaboo</button> yes, it works! All browser compatibility updates at a glance, Frequently asked questions about MDN Plus. To set the disabled to false using the name property of the input: If you are using jQuery, you can remove the disabled attribute by setting it to "false": code of the previous answers don't seem to work in inline mode, but there is a workaround: method 3. see demo https://jsfiddle.net/eliz82/xqzccdfg/. If we need the value of href or any other attribute exactly as written in the HTML, we can use getAttribute. I can have the button hidden to begin with, using the hidden attribute. Boolean attributes are considered to be true if they're present on the or the attribute's name, with no leading or trailing whitespace. A string containing the value to assign to the attribute. Thanks for contributing an answer to Stack Overflow! Summary Use the removeAttribute () to remove an attribute from a specified element. Changing a melody from major to minor key, twice. Also one can read all attributes using elem.attributes: a collection of objects that belong to a built-in Attr class, with name and value properties. Another, simpler way would be to add the checks to CSS selector: Any value, standard properties have types described in the spec, We can assign anything to an attribute, but it becomes a string. HTML disabled Attribute - W3Schools Famous professor refuses to cite my paper that was published before him in the same area, '80s'90s science fiction children's book about a gold monkey robot stuck on a planet like a junkyard. 600), Medical research made understandable with AI (ep. HTMLElement: hidden property - Web APIs | MDN - MDN Web Docs Home JavaScript DOM JavaScript removeAttribute.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. Making statements based on opinion; back them up with references or personal experience. Content available under a Creative Commons license. Remove display styling, and you should be good to go. 600), Medical research made understandable with AI (ep. Why do people say a dog is 'harmless' but not 'harmful'? For instance, if the tag is , then the DOM object has body.id="page". How do i disable a submit button when checkbox is uncheck? Is there a way to access such attributes? And then the same backwards: But there are exclusions, for instance input.value synchronizes only from attribute property, but not back: That feature may actually come in handy, because the user actions may lead to value changes, and then after them, if we want to recover the original value from HTML, its in the attribute. Syntax: need to add "child of div" to change disabled input, Remove disabled attribute onClick of disabled form field, Add disabled attribute to input element using Javascript, How to remove the attribute "disabled" from input siblings when i click on a submit input. Connect and share knowledge within a single location that is structured and easy to search. I will be highly grateful to you . Disabled aspx button lose bootstrap class, Toggle disable attribute using javascript, how to enable a input field and set a value at the same time. Listing all user-defined definitions used in a function call, Should I use 'denote' or 'be'? AND "I am just so excited.". I can then have the button appear by removing the hidden attribute using the removeAttribute function in the DOM. The removeAttr () method is an inbuilt method in jQuery which is used to remove one or more attributes from the selected elements. We need a non-standard attribute. @mplungjan I like your snippet, but I need to use the hidden attribute and not the display:none styling. I can have the button hidden to begin with, using the hidden attribute. version added: 1.2.3 .removeData ( [name ] ) name Type: String A string naming the piece of data to delete. Connect and share knowledge within a single location that is structured and easy to search. is this posible ('id1', 'id2', 'id3') ? The first is to find all links using document.querySelectorAll('a') and then filter out what we need: Please note: we use link.getAttribute('href'). How can I remove/add the onclick/style attribute in this tag using.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ide, The future of collective knowledge sharing, your code and text are inconsistent with each other. DOM properties are not always strings. All attributes starting with data- are reserved for programmers use. yes it works, but I had a lot of input need to do the same thing.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ide, The future of collective knowledge sharing, How do you add/remove hidden in


Transfer Portal Iowa Hawkeyes Women's Basketball, Cigna Medical Claim Address, Articles A